Visual Size Comparison
Understanding dumpster sizes can be challenging. Here's a visual comparison showing how 10, 20, 30, and 40-yard dumpsters compare in capacity:
Quick Reference: A standard pickup truck bed holds about 2-3 cubic yards. So a 10-yard dumpster equals about 4-5 truckloads, while a 40-yard dumpster equals 16-20 truckloads.
Dumpster Size Breakdown
Each dumpster size serves different project needs. Here's what each size can handle for Fort Lauderdale projects:
10
Cubic Yards
Small Projects
Dimensions: 12'L × 8'W × 4'H
Weight Limit: 2-3 tons
Best For: Small bathroom remodels, garage cleanouts, small deck removal
20
Cubic Yards
Medium Projects
Dimensions: 22'L × 8'W × 4'H
Weight Limit: 3-4 tons
Best For: Kitchen remodels, roof tear-offs (up to 1500 sq ft), whole-house cleanouts
30
Cubic Yards
Large Projects
Dimensions: 22'L × 8'W × 6'H
Weight Limit: 4-5 tons
Best For: New construction, major renovations, commercial projects, large hurricane debris cleanup
40
Cubic Yards
Extra Large
Dimensions: 22'L × 8'W × 8'H
Weight Limit: 6-8 tons
Best For: Commercial construction, demolition projects, multiple property cleanouts, post-hurricane major debris

How to Estimate Your Needs
Use this simple method to estimate which dumpster size you need for your Fort Lauderdale project:
List Your Materials
Inventory everything you'll be disposing: drywall, flooring, furniture, appliances, yard waste, etc. Different materials have different densities.
Calculate Volume
Estimate the total cubic yards: 1 full-size mattress = 1 cubic yard, 1 kitchen cabinet = 1-2 cubic yards, 100 sq ft of drywall = 2-3 cubic yards.
Consider Weight
Heavy materials like concrete, brick, or wet debris fill space quickly. 10 cubic yards of concrete weighs 10+ tons (needs special dumpster).
Add Buffer Space
Add 20-30% extra capacity to your estimate. It's better to have a little extra room than to need a second dumpster rental.
Fort Lauderdale-Specific Considerations
- Parking Restrictions: Many neighborhoods require permits for street placement
- Driveway Concerns: Consider weight limits on driveways, especially with heavy loads
- Weather Impact: Tropical rain can quickly fill dumpsters with water weight
- Historic Districts: Some areas have additional restrictions on dumpster placement
- Hurricane Season: Plan ahead—demand increases after storms
Making Your Final Decision
Choosing the right dumpster size saves time, money, and hassle. Here's a quick decision guide:
Choose 10 Yards If:
- Small bathroom remodel (1 bathroom)
- Single-room cleanout
- Small deck removal (under 200 sq ft)
- Limited driveway or street space
- Budget-conscious project
Choose 20 Yards If:
- Kitchen remodel
- Whole-house cleanout (3 bedroom home)
- Roof tear-off (up to 1500 sq ft)
- Moderate yard cleanup
- Most common Fort Lauderdale renovation projects
Choose 30 Yards If:
- Major home addition or renovation
- New construction debris
- Large hurricane debris cleanup
- Commercial tenant improvement
- When you're unsure—it's better to have extra space
Choose 40 Yards If:
- Whole-house demolition
- Large commercial construction
- Major post-hurricane property cleanup
- Multiple property cleanouts
- When maximum efficiency is needed for large volumes
